From 04db54dfcad948e33bba8802905da5b057730f13 Mon Sep 17 00:00:00 2001 From: Synced Synapse Date: Tue, 31 Mar 2015 00:19:38 +0100 Subject: [PATCH] Fix crash introduced earlier when removing swipe to refresh --- .../xbmc/kore/ui/MediaFileListFragment.java | 3 ++ .../layout/fragment_generic_media_list.xml | 30 +++++++++++-------- 2 files changed, 21 insertions(+), 12 deletions(-) diff --git a/app/src/main/java/org/xbmc/kore/ui/MediaFileListFragment.java b/app/src/main/java/org/xbmc/kore/ui/MediaFileListFragment.java index c4cf1b2..58044c0 100644 --- a/app/src/main/java/org/xbmc/kore/ui/MediaFileListFragment.java +++ b/app/src/main/java/org/xbmc/kore/ui/MediaFileListFragment.java @@ -22,6 +22,7 @@ import android.os.Handler; import android.os.Parcel; import android.os.Parcelable; import android.support.v4.app.Fragment; +import android.support.v4.widget.SwipeRefreshLayout; import android.view.LayoutInflater; import android.view.MenuItem; import android.view.View; @@ -88,6 +89,7 @@ public class MediaFileListFragment extends Fragment { Queue mediaQueueFileLocation = new LinkedList<>(); @InjectView(R.id.list) GridView folderGridView; + @InjectView(R.id.swipe_refresh_layout) SwipeRefreshLayout swipeRefreshLayout; @InjectView(android.R.id.empty) TextView emptyView; public static MediaFileListFragment newInstance(final String media) { @@ -127,6 +129,7 @@ public class MediaFileListFragment extends Fragment { ButterKnife.inject(this, root); hostManager = HostManager.getInstance(getActivity()); + swipeRefreshLayout.setEnabled(false); emptyView.setOnClickListener(new View.OnClickListener() { @Override diff --git a/app/src/main/res/layout/fragment_generic_media_list.xml b/app/src/main/res/layout/fragment_generic_media_list.xml index 228cd9a..515d316 100644 --- a/app/src/main/res/layout/fragment_generic_media_list.xml +++ b/app/src/main/res/layout/fragment_generic_media_list.xml @@ -22,18 +22,24 @@ - + android:layout_height="match_parent"> + +